ЄС-11

Цифрова комутаційна система

Науково-виробничий центр
"Автоматизовані мікропроцесорні системи"
ЄДРПОУ: 13807402 тел: +380-32-237-21-36

Користувальницькькі налаштування

Налаштування сайту


extrasoft:tracer:index

Tracer

Призначення

Програма Tracer призначена для обробки результатів трасування пакетних видів сигналізацій.

Можливості

  1. отримання даних зі станції через допоміжні програми AgentRgt та NexusSrv
  2. отримання даних з попередньо збережених файлів
  3. перегляд отриманих даних в декодованому вигляді
  4. перегляд отриманих даних в шістнадцятковому вигляді
  5. збереження прийнятих даних у файл

Системні вимоги

  1. Windows 2000 і вище
  2. Windows Internet Explorer 6.0 і вище

Архітектура

Опис програми

Вікно програми складається з таких частин:

  1. меню
  2. панель інструментів
  3. список пакетів
  4. багатофункціональне вікно відображення (декодованого пакету, шістнадцяткових даних або налаштування колонок сітки списку пакетів)
  5. рядок статусу

Вигляд головного вікна

На панелі інструментів є такі кнопки:

  • Створити новий сеанс трасування
  • Зберегти поточний сеанс трасування
  • Копіювати дані з вікна декодування
  • Автопрокрутка
  • Інформація про програму

Є два режими створення сеансу трасування - з файлу і зі станції. При відкритті файлу трасування слід вказати лише метод декодування пакетів. При отриманні даних зі станції, слід вказати IP-адресу і udp-порт на яких працює програма NexusSrv - транслятор отриманих від AgentRgt даних. Діалог налаштувань сеансу виглядає так:

Діалог створення нового сеансу трасування

При натисканні правої кнопки миші на списку пакетів з'являється контекстне меню, яке дозволяє експортувати інформацію про трасовані пакети в текстовому і декодованому вигляді.

Основні колонки списку трасованих пакетів:

  • № пакету - порядковий номер отриманих даних
  • TimeStamp - часова мітка події - відносний час
  • LinkID - ідентифікатор ланки сигналізації, яка внесла такий запис в базу
  • Flags - прапорці, які визначають подію (T - передача, R - прийом, E - прийом з помилкою контрольної суми)
  • RepeatCnt - кількість повторів однакових пакетів (як правило колапсування використовується для FISU)

Решта полів залежать від протоколу сигналізації.

Вікно відображення можна переключити у режим декодування, шістнадцяткових даних і вибору профіля відображення за допомогою кнопок внизу.

Налаштування програми для отримання даних зі станції

  1. Включити в роботу програму CommSrv з базою даних, де визначено шлях до процесорів, ланки СКС7 яких будуть трасуватися.
  2. Включити в роботу програму NexusSrv (знаходиться, як правило, в папці, де і програма Tracer). Вікно, яке з'явиться на екрані, згорнути та проконтролювати появу піктограми у системній області (system Tray).
  3. Налаштувати та включити в роботу програму AgentRgt. Для цого внести необхідні зміни в файлах *.ini та AgentRgtPump.cfg. Проконтролювати після запуску програми що модуль AgentRgtPump.cfg під'єднаний. Дані можна знімати як в ручному режимі так і автоматичному, якщо поставити програму на виконання в Резидент.
  4. Включити в роботу програму Tracer.
  5. За допомогою програми Agent встановити на необхідних ланках режим трасування Плати →Сервіс →Керування ланками сигналізації СКС7 →TraceOn та проконтролювати появу повідомлень в вікні програми Tracer.

ПРИМІТКА: Не забудьте після закінчення роботи з програмою виключити режим трасування на ланках →TraceOff.

Синтаксис файлів трасування протоколів

інформація про синтаксис файлів наведена в секції для розробників

extrasoft/tracer/index.txt · В останнє змінено: 2015/04/17 15:25 (зовнішнє редагування)